Make a Real Difference, Every Shift!
If you’re compassionate, reliable and ready to learn, we’ll give you the tools, training and local, on-the-ground leadership support to help create safe, nurturing home environments where young people can feel secure, develop life skills and start believing in their future again. You’ll never feel like you’re doing this alone our leaders are right there with you.
What You’ll Be Doing
- Provide consistent day-to-day care in a supportive home setting
- Build positive, trusting relationships that offer stability and encouragement
- Support daily routines, schooling, appointments and recreational activities
- Follow tailored care plans that reflect each young person’s goals
- Maintain clear, professional documentation
Why You’ll Love Working with Kanda
- Rates starting from $44.59 + super and penalties
- Flexible casual and part-time shifts to suit your lifestyle
- Paid induction with supported shadow shifts to set you up for success
- Strong local leadership presence real people, on the ground, ready to support you when you need it
- You’re never alone, our on-call team is available to support you outside business hours
- Paid training including Therapeutic Crisis Intervention and The Sanctuary Model
- Wellness initiatives plus 24/7 access to the Sonder wellbeing app
- Access to an employee rewards hub providing savings and cashback across everyday purchases
- Employee recognition initiatives, including gift vouchers and service rewards
- Company vehicle provided for use during shifts, no wear and tear on your personal car
- Free Orbit World Travel Club membership and travel perks
- Genuine long-term career opportunities as Kanda continues to grow
What You’ll Need
- Current driver’s licence (minimum P2)
- Working with Children Blue Card and NDIS Worker Screening Check (or willingness to obtain)
- Is willing to obtain or currently hold First Aid and CPR certifications
- Completed or willingness to enrol in a Certificate IV or Diploma in Community Services, Youth Work, Social Work or related field
- Experience with young people (or in disability, mental health, aged care, childcare) is valued but not essential
